Those with the f23, does anyone get the check engine light often? I'm getting 3 everytime boost builds. The codes are:

Mass Airflow sensor
Running Too Rich
Cant remember the last one.

I will try and get the exact codes tomorrow when I go to get them cleared again.

Today, code P1106 "Fuel Air Metering" was read today. Whats up?

Only running 6lbs, and it has been tuned.

im pretty sure you have a MAP sensor. how much boost are you running? because anything over 11 lbs through the stock MAP sensor will throw a CEL. have you had the AFC tuned yet? if not, you might wanna throw it on the dyno and hook it up to a wideband to get some accurate A/F ratio numbers.
